Savills Moving to New Carmel Valley Office: What It Means for Businesses

Savills Moving to New Carmel Valley Office

Savills Expands: A Fresh Start in Carmel Valley

In an exciting development for San Diego's commercial real estate sector, Savills, a prominent commercial real estate brokerage, is set to relocate its San Diego County headquarters to a new, larger office space in Carmel Valley. The move to 11321 El Camino Real comes as part of Savills' expansion strategy, reflecting both growth in their staff and services, and a move towards a more efficient workspace.

A Thoughtful Transition

The new office spans 4,773 square feet, providing Savills with more room than their previous 4,400-square-foot location. According to Savills Vice Chairman Shane Poppen, the new office is not only slightly larger but also significantly better configured. Designed from scratch, it offers an optimized mix of private offices and open work areas, which are becoming increasingly popular in modern office environments where collaboration is key.

Modern Amenities for a Dynamic Work Environment

Located within the Coastal Collection at Torrey Reserve, Savills will enjoy a range of modern amenities including a fitness center, a conference center, outdoor lounges, a café, and even Bright Horizons Daycare and a yoga studio. These facilities are particularly appealing as they cater to both the professional and personal wellness of employees, which is an essential aspect in today’s corporate landscape.

Strategically Positioned for Success

Poppen notes that this new location places Savills at the center of one of San Diego’s busiest business enclaves. This strategic move not only enhances their visibility but also promotes their brand, as they will be the sole tenant of the stand-alone building, proudly displaying their name.

Building a Stronger Team

The push to relocate is not merely about space; it’s about continued growth. Under Poppen’s leadership, the San Diego office aims to add more experienced professionals from the real estate market to better serve their clients. The current San Diego staff, which started with just five employees, is expected to grow significantly as fully functioning teams require robust support structures.

The Search for the Perfect Location

Before settling on this new office, Savills evaluated numerous options within the marketplace. Poppen emphasized the desire to make a striking impression with their new office, stating, “We wanted to make a splash and have something that really felt special.” Their persistence in finding the ideal space underscores the importance of a well-considered approach to office relocation, particularly in competitive industries.

Future Growth and Opportunities

As Savills prepares for the move in August, it represents not just a physical relocation but a commitment to growth and excellence in real estate services. This new office presents opportunities for enhanced collaboration, innovation, and employee engagement, essential for attracting top talent and servicing clients effectively.

Harnessing Generative AI: Transforming Innovation Ideas into Reality

Update Unlocking Innovation: How Generative AI Can Fuel Your Ideas In today's fast-paced business environment, the ability to visualize concepts effectively is crucial for securing buy-in from stakeholders. A common challenge faced by teams is articulating their innovation ideas through visuals that resonate. Fortunately, the landscape of Generative AI offers tools that can transform abstract ideas into compelling representations that engage and persuade. Why Visualization is Key for Innovation Clarity is paramount in the journey from concept to realization. If audiences cannot visualize an idea, they won't invest resources or support it. In this case, Generative AI emerges as a powerful ally, capable of matching the right visualization tools to different stages of development and types of concepts. Start Lo-Fi to Align Early: First Impressions Matter At the inception of an idea, rapid and rough representations provide a crucial opportunity for feedback. Early stages should embrace simplicity rather than polish. For product ideas, leveraging tools like Midjourney or DALL·E allows teams to generate quick visuals that outline the product’s core functionality or design. When it comes to services, ChatGPT can assist in scripting sample customer interactions, effectively describing the service flow. For process innovations, collaborative tools such as Whimsical or Miro enable teams to map workflows in real-time, fostering a participative space for brainstorming. The aim is not to impress but to ignite conversations around the idea’s potential. Elevate Visual Fidelity to Build Belief in Your Concepts Once there’s interest in the idea, it's time to enhance the visuals. Higher fidelity serves to build belief in the innovation. Products can be mocked up using platforms like Canva and Figma, allowing teams to showcase packaging designs and user interfaces in context. For services, employing tools like Tome or Synthesia facilitates the creation of storyboards, with avatars guiding stakeholders through the customer journey, providing a life-like representation of the experience. For process redesigns, platforms like Runway ML can simulate future workflows, allowing people to envision the system at work. Creating MVPs: Testing Ideas in the Real World As ideas progress, experimentation becomes crucial. Building a Minimum Viable Product (MVP) allows teams to learn quickly, validating concepts in a real-world context. For products, platforms like Glide or Bubble enable the creation of functional prototypes or apps without diving into complex coding. In service innovation, combining ChatGPT with form builders like Tally can simulate booking systems and customer interactions, allowing for rigorous testing. Lastly, tools such as Notion or Retool can facilitate the construction of dashboards or internal tools for early testing, further aligning with user needs. How New City America is Building Business Better in Urban Areas

Update Transforming Urban Spaces: New City America's VisionIn recent years, urban revitalization has taken on new meaning as communities seek innovative solutions to enhance their environments. A leading figure in this movement is Marco Li Mandri, the president of New City America, whose efforts have been instrumental in transforming business districts across the nation. With notable projects like Little Italy in San Diego—which has now become a template for urban development—Li Mandri's commitment to improving urban spaces fuels his mission. His methodology emphasizes the crucial role of special districts designed to improve neighborhood conditions.Business Improvement Districts: A New ApproachBusiness Improvement Districts (BIDs), the cornerstone of New City America's strategy, are revolutionizing how cities manage community needs. These districts involve assessments paid by local businesses and property owners aimed at funding supplemental services that bolster local economies. The establishment of over 100 BIDs reflects a growing recognition of their transformative potential. In 2024 alone, these districts yielded approximately $120 million—evidence that local investment can yield significant returns.The Success of Little ItalyLittle Italy serves as a shining example of how strategic planning and dedicated community effort can revitalize a neighborhood. Originally a declining area, it has been revitalized into a vibrant hub of restaurants, shops, and art. Key to this transformation has been the formation of the Little Italy Association, which helped orchestrate initiatives that enhanced public spaces and promoted local businesses. As Li Mandri states, "The positive changes we instituted there are replicable and applicable to neighborhoods nationwide. It’s about fostering community spirit and enhancing local economies." Li Mandri’s background lends credibility to his initiatives. Growing up in Little Italy, he is personally invested in the success of the neighborhood and has spent decades refining the techniques that unlock community potential.Bridging Community Needs with City ResourcesThere is an increasing realization that cities often lack the funds required to maintain public spaces and provide necessary services. New City America steps in where city budgets fall short, offering solutions that enhance the quality of life. These improvements range from better landscaping and street cleaning to creating engaging public gathering spaces. Li Mandri argues that these efforts are essential because, “they are really the way we’re going to run cities and neighborhoods in the future.”Future Opportunities and ChallengesThe overarching goal of New City America is to establish a replicable model for revitalization in cities across America. Challenges persist, particularly regarding community buy-in and sustainable funding, which are vital for the long-term success of any BID initiative. Exploring the Resilience of San Diego's Retail Market and Its Future Opportunities

Update The Resilience of San Diego's Retail Market Recent developments in San Diego's retail scene speak volumes about its enduring strength. Despite a slight increase in vacancy rates due to the bankruptcy of prominent national chains, local experts assert that the market remains robust. According to John Hickman, managing director of NewMark Merrill, a notable trend points towards a low vacancy rate and high occupancy in local shopping centers. This stability comes amid temporary disruptions, emphasizing the market's overall resilience. Notable Recent Deals Two recent transactions exemplify the continued appeal of San Diego's retail spaces. Brixton Capital's acquisition of the Civic Center Plaza shopping center in San Marcos highlights the ongoing investment interest in the region. Similarly, Capstone Advisors updated its Mission Escondido shopping center with contemporary renovations and an impressive tenant list. These actions signal an optimistic outlook for retail property values and occupancy in San Diego County. Convergence of Transformation and Investment Capital improvements often play a significant role in revitalizing retail centers. In Escondido, Capstone Advisors invested in making the Mission Escondido center competitive. CEO Alex Zikakis shared that improvements included modernized facilities, electric vehicle charging stations, and upgraded landscaping, all aimed at attracting diverse tenants. These enhancements are pivotal in ensuring long-term success for shopping centers. Growth Indicators Amidst Challenges Despite facing challenges such as an uptick in vacancies, key indicators reveal persistent growth potential. Historical data indicates that San Diego’s retail market typically outperforms other areas in terms of occupancy and rent growth. With a focus on maintaining and improving the quality of retail spaces, stakeholders are adapting to market changes, allowing them to stay competitive and attractive.
